Skip to main content

Sign up

HackerSquad uses OAuth for authentication. Head to hackersquad.io and sign in with one of the supported providers:
  • GitHub — recommended for developers
  • Google — sign in with your Google account
  • LinkedIn — great for professional networking context
If you sign in with multiple providers using the same email address, your accounts are automatically linked into a single HackerSquad identity.

For companies

Get your company set up and run your first developer event.
1

Create your company profile

After signing in, navigate to the Company Portal and click Create Company. Fill in your company name, upload a logo, add a description, and enter your website URL.
2

Choose a plan

Select a subscription tier that fits your needs. The Free plan lets you create up to 3 events per month. Upgrade to Starter, Pro, Scale, or Enterprise for more events, Cloud IDE hours, and advanced features. See Plans & Pricing for details.
3

Create your first event

Go to Events in the Company Portal and click Create Event. Set the event name, date and time, location, format (Hack Night, Hackathon, Workshop, etc.), and add a registration link.
4

View your dashboard

Your Company Dashboard shows total events, upcoming events, submission stats, and quick access to DevRel tools like the Social Content Generator.
Complete your company profile before creating events — a verified profile builds trust with builders and sponsors.

For builders

Discover events, register, and start building.
1

Browse events

Visit the Events directory to explore upcoming hack nights, hackathons, workshops, and more. Filter by format, date, or location to find events near you.
2

Register for an event

Click on an event and register as a Hacker (if you plan to build a project) or a Spectator (to observe and network). Hackers can share their project idea, tech stack, and whether they’re looking for a team.
3

Submit your project

During the event, submit your project with a name, description, GitHub link, and demo details. Select the sponsor technologies you used and request a demo slot if available.
Register as a Hacker if you plan to build and submit a project. Register as a Spectator to observe and network.

For Squad Leaders

Squad Leaders are community organizers who run HackerSquad events in their region and earn revenue from sponsorships.
1

Apply to the program

Visit the Squad Leader application page and complete the application form with your background, region, and community vision.
2

Get approved

The HackerSquad team reviews applications and notifies you by email. Once approved, you gain access to the Squad Leader dashboard.
For the full application guide and program details, see Squad Leader Overview.